We need Altidore.
Dempsey has done great, but he's no target man. I agree with a few others I've seen that a big part of Bradley's problem is not having a targetman to relieve the pressure. Get Altidore to hold up play, dump it back and let guys like Bradley and Jones collect the pass and force it up to others making runs.
Without a guy who can hold up play, we're stuck in a 4-6-0. It's been good enough to survive but we don't get much farther without a proper forward. It's too bad, because there's a lot to like about this team and a good run could be in the cards at full strength.
